Navigating Difficult Talks About Body Image and Societal Pressures

Connections, whether loving, kin-related, or platonic, are built on dialogue. But what transpires when the conversations become tough, when conflicts develop, or when delicate subjects must be discussed? The ability to manage these difficult talks is essential for maintaining positive and robust relationships. This writing investigates the art of difficult conversations, centered on the complicated issue of body image and cultural influences, presenting helpful strategies for dealing with these delicate issues productively and enhancing bonds with individuals.

Understanding the Origins of Discord Surrounding Self-Perception:

Discord surrounding self-perception frequently originates from a fundamental cultural demand to comply with unattainable beauty standards. These ideals, often perpetuated by media, advertising, and social media, can contribute to:

Internalized Negative Body Image: Persons, specifically women, may internalize these norms, leading to self-blame, body dissatisfaction, and even disordered eating patterns.
Social Comparison: Constant exposure to perfected images can foster a atmosphere of competition, contributing to sensations of incompetence and diminished self-regard.
Objectification and Sexualization: The stress on physical attributes, particularly in the instance of breasts, can contribute to the dehumanization and sensualization of girls, devaluing them to their physical attributes.
These social expectations can produce tension within bonds, resulting in:

Communication Breakdowns: Trouble in expressing apprehensions about body image or societal pressures without feeling judged or ignored.
Relationship Tension: Ill will and conflict can arise when partners hold differing opinions on self-perception or have disparate experiences with cultural influences.
Emotional Distress: Persons may undergo anxiety, depression, or other psychological difficulties due to the perpetual pressure to adhere to unrealistic ideals of beauty.
Preparing for Tough Talks About Self-Perception:

Before commencing a talk about physical appearance, it's vital to:

Generate a Safe and Supportive Environment: Select a time and place where you and your partner sense at ease and safe to communicate your ideas and feelings without dread of condemnation or censure.
Reflect on Your Own Physical Appearance: Grasp your own relationship with your physical form and how social expectations have affected you.
Center on Empathy and Compassion: Approach the conversation with compassion and a sincere desire to comprehend your partner's point of view.
Set Clear Boundaries: Set clear limits for the talk, ensuring that both sides feel valued and listened to.

Efficient Communication Methods:

Engaged Listening: Focus intently on what your partner is saying, both get more info verbally and through actions. Validate their sentiments and confirm their situations, even though you don't agree with the same point of view.
"I" Statements: Communicate your own sentiments and situations employing "first-person statements, like "It concerns me when..." or "I'm afraid that..." This stops faulting or charging your partner.
Challenge Societal Norms Together: Have frank and sincere conversations about the unattainable beauty standards reinforced by the media and society. Question these expectations together and investigate other perspectives.
Center on Health and Well-being: Alter the focus from outer beauty to general health and wellness. Promote wholesome practices, for example exercise, diet, and self-maintenance, that foster both bodily and emotional well-being.
Look for Help: In the event that you or your significant other are facing challenges with body image issues, think about looking for help from a psychologist with expertise in body image concerns.
